The Multiphase Doubly Salient Electro-Magnetic Fault-Tolerant Starter Generator With Symmetrical Phase Inductances

Starter generator technology is the core technology of more electric/all electric aircrafts.The aerospace,military vehicles and other industries raise higher requirement for the reliability of starter generator system,and even requested that the machine have the fault-tolerant ability to operate with equal or derating capability in case of failure.One important technique to improve the reliability and achieve the fault-tolerant function of the starter-generator is to design multi-phase machines.Since the doubly salient electromagnetic machine(DSEM)have a good characteristic of voltage regulating and is suitable to be a starter generator,it is very necessary to carry out the study of fault-tolerant technology with this type of multi-phase starter-generator.This thesis contains the follows:To improve motor fault tolerance and prevent the spread of the fault,the redundancy structure with multi-phase and fault isolation technique should be adopted with the analysis of the DSEM failure.Based on the design requirements for DSEM,the relationship between performance parameters and topology parameters that includes stator pole,rotor pole and their pole arc coefficient was analyzed.The constraint rules of the machine stator pole,rotor pole and their pole arc coefficient for multiphase doubly salient machine was given.In the conventional multi-phase DSEM,the phase with short magnetic circuit has large phase inductance,and the phase with long magnetic circuit has little phase inductance.In order to solve this phase asymmetry problem,a new DSEM with short pitch field windings was proposed by winding three armature coils of one phase in different locations.A new five-phase Doubly Salient Electromagnetic Generator(DSEG)with the field winding curling around three stator poles was proposed in this paper.To calculate the airgap magnetic flux density,the analytical model of the air length in the magnetic path in different positions was deduced,which includes airgap,stator slot air length and rotor slot air length.The analytical model has a high accuracy to analyze the static magnetic characteristics of DSEG.A novel six-phase DSEM with little commutation torque ripple and complementary dual channel was proposed.It was pointed out that only the six-phase DSEM with field winding wound across one pole has symmetrical phases.And the analytical model of the pole overlap angle was deduced to express the inductance models for the six-phase DSEM.As a typical example,the analytical models of the inter-turn short-circuit current both in generator state and motor state were proposed,which showed that the short-circuit current should be diagnosed and isolated quickly.A four-phase DSEM fault-tolerant power converter with five arms was proposed.It can take the advantage of working in half cycle of the DSEM,and achieve fault tolerance with single-tube open and single-phase open circuit.Two IPMs were used to build a six-phase dual-channel fault-tolerant converter to realize the fault tolerance with single-tube,single-phase and single-channel open circuit.The rectifier topologies of the multi-phase fault-tolerant DSEG were presented.Take the four-phase DSEM as an example,the fault-tolerant characteristics were analyzed when it was normal,have a fault of single-tube or single-phase open circuit.The Matthew effect on current of the DSEG was pointed out,which makes the larger phase current larger and larger.The prototype machines with 24/18-pole four-phase and 12/10-pole six-phase DSEG have been developed with the above characteristic.And an experimental platform was set up to carry out the verify experiments for the multi-phase Doubly Salient Electromagnetic Starter Generator(DSES/G)and its bi-directional converter.
